Board Approves Caltrans Apportionment Exchange Agreement
Trusted by teams at
Description
The Sierra County Board of Supervisors approved an agreement with the California Department of Transportation under the Federal Apportionment Exchange and State Match Program for the Plumbago Road bridge mitigation project, with an estimated $130,000 in federal funds and no local match. The agreement allows the County to exchange its RSTP apportionments for flexible state highway funds each year.

Renewal Info
Annual exchange mechanism under Streets and Highways Code Sections 182.6 and 182.9; future additional federal obligations to be encumbered via Authorization to Proceed and finance letters.
